
Why Awareness Matters
Breast cancer remains one of the most common cancers, and early detection through regular self-checks, mammograms, and routine medical screenings can make a life-changing difference. Awareness campaigns not only encourage early diagnosis but also remind us that no one should face cancer alone.

Standing Together
Breast Cancer Awareness Month is also about solidarity. Wearing a pink ribbon, attending awareness walks, or simply starting conversations about breast health helps reduce stigma and encourages open dialogue. Together, communities can make an impact by supporting ongoing research, fundraising efforts, and local support groups.
